Default Pump woes

Just finished a v6 to v8 swap with blower and cam set up with new fuel pump. Just started today while driving the motor cuts off with no warning. Go to check the fuses and fuel pump fuse blown twice today any ideas guys thank you.

What pump and what amp fuse? The aftermarket high flow fuel pumps draw a lot more current than factory pumps.

This is too easy... Volt meter or if you're brave a test light?? What am I missing here? Someone just posted a how to test the pump to ensure no electrical failure there and then the wiring independently.

These trucks use Fuel Pump Relays. Maybe during the higher duty demand on the pump relay, the one that used to support the stock one sufficiently,, now goes into arrest. Swap'em around, (Horn is a good test subject participant), and see if drivability improves. If yes, buy a new relay. If no..., find source of short "blowing fuse?" It could be the pump itself. Check grounds!
